Zanardi rules out future move to DTM

Zanardi rules out future move to DTM

28 December 2012

Alex Zanardi says he will not race for BMW in DTM next year, having held discussions over a potential drive in the series. The Paralympic gold medalist, who lost both legs in a CART accident in 2001, will instead spend more time with his family.

"We did have a conversation about taking it seriously further on but I decided it would be a little bit too much for me to be involved full-time for the whole season next year," Zanardi told The Telegraph of his decision.

"It would mean I wouldn’t have time for things I’d enjoy - like cycling and fishing with my son - so I decided to wait for the next train."

Zanardi has enjoyed numerous outings with BMW since his crash, driving for the German manufacturer in the WTCC and also testing a modified Formula 1 car. Most recently, he tested a DTM BMW M3 for the company's 40th anniversary event.
